Hamilton Coleman continues to set the amateur golf world alight, booking his place in Saturday’s 36-hole final of the U.S. Junior Amateur at Trinity Forest Golf Club in Dallas after a commanding 5-and-4 semifinal victory that never reached the 16th hole. The 17-year-old from Augusta, Georgia, now faces Vietnam’s Nguyen Anh Minh for the national title—just the latest chapter in a breakout season that has pushed “Hamilton Coleman golf” to the top of search rankings worldwide. Road to Trinity Forest • Coleman opened the championship with rounds of 67-68 in stroke play, earning the No. 2 seed in match play. • He then dispatched opponents by margins of 6&5, 3&2 and 4&3 before his semifinal rout, displaying the same laser-sharp iron play that powered him to victory at last fall’s Junior PLAYERS Championship, where he edged Blades Brown in a two-hole playoff at TPC Sawgrass. Why Coleman Is Trending Recruiting buzz: The Lakeside High School senior recently committed to the University of Georgia, joining a program that produced PGA TOUR winners such as Brian Harman and Chris Kirk. Stat sheet stunner: He has climbed inside the top 650 of the World Amateur Golf Ranking despite playing a limited national schedule. Social surge: Coleman’s @hammygolf Instagram account eclipsed 25 k followers this week after a viral clip of a 348-yard drive in Dallas. What a U.S. Junior Title Would Mean • A spot in next year’s U.S. Open at Oakmont, provided he maintains amateur status. • An invitation to the 2026 Masters—particularly poignant for an Augusta native who grew up less than five miles from Augusta National. • Instant name recognition with college-team sponsors and NIL partners looking for the next Ludvig Åberg-style success story. Course Fit Trinity Forest rewards creative shot-making and aggressive lag putting—two areas where Coleman’s statistical strokes-gained numbers have excelled all summer. His towering ball flight neutralizes firm greens, while his 180-mph ball speed turns 490-yard par-4s into wedge holes.
